TL;DR
QA Engineer (AI): Ensuring the stability and reliability of critical-care software used in ICUs, operating rooms, and other life-saving environments with an accent on manual testing, exploratory testing, and automated test coverage. Focus on building AI-assisted testing workflows, validating APIs and databases, investigating complex defects, and mentoring QA engineers.

Location: Fully remote for candidates from Uzbekistan only

Salary: From $1,500 per month, negotiable and adjusted according to exchange-rate changes.

Company

Develops critical-care software that supports clinical teams in intensive care units, operating rooms, and other medical environments worldwide.

What you will do

  • Design, maintain, and execute test plans, test cases, and test scripts for critical-care products.
  • Perform manual and exploratory testing, identify defects, and investigate root causes.
  • Collaborate with R&D, Product, and Support teams to reproduce and resolve software issues.
  • Track defects through discovery, resolution, and verification.
  • Build and maintain automated tests using modern testing frameworks to expand coverage and accelerate releases.
  • Mentor junior QA engineers and promote QA best practices.

Requirements

  • BSc in Computer Science, Engineering, or an equivalent qualification.
  • 5+ years of experience as a QA Engineer, Software Tester, or in a similar role.
  • Strong knowledge of QA methodologies, tools, processes, manual testing, and exploratory testing.
  • Hands-on experience with test automation frameworks, including Selenium, Cypress, or Playwright.
  • Experience using AI tools or building AI-assisted testing workflows to improve quality, speed, and coverage.
  • Knowledge of SQL, API testing with Postman or SoapUI, and scripting or programming with Python, JavaScript, or Java.

Nice to have

  • Experience with WCF, web services, distributed systems, multithreading, or the Task Parallel Library.
  • Familiarity with C# and .NET environments.
  • Experience with performance testing, profiling, and troubleshooting tools.
  • Background in medical IT systems, including HL7, DICOM, or medical device integrations.
  • Understanding of application security best practices and experience leading QA efforts or mentoring testers.

Culture & Benefits

  • Fully remote work with a five-day, 40-hour workweek.
  • Official employment with paid annual leave.
  • Salary paid on time and adjusted for exchange-rate changes.
  • Work on software that supports patient care in critical medical environments.
